Emmaus Ministry
Emmaus is a ministry whose stated purpose is to reveal Messiah through the Law, the Prophets, and the Psalms. This is an Old
Testament focus to understand our faith in this New Covenant. The Apostle Paul said the Law was our schoolmaster to bring us to
Christ. Jesus on the road to Emmaus used concepts from the Law, the Prophets, and the Psalms to bring to life the role of the
Messiah that he would fulfill. Emmaus deals with the workings of our faith. How could a Passover crucifixion 2,000 years ago
set us free from sin? Why was the Spirit sent on Pentecost? Why is Jesus called the Lamb of God? And why is the blood of the Lamb
so vital to our faith? Jesus used the Law of Moses, the Prophets, and the Psalms to open the understanding of the Scriptures to
the twelve in an upper room after His resurrection. Emmaus continues this opening of the understanding of our Old Testament scriptures.
